WebApr 26, 2024 · When considering the word everyone, it makes sense to think of many people in a group. The natural conclusion then is to believe everyone is plural. It’s not. Everyone is singular. One way to think about it is that everyone refers to each individual in a group. WebMar 18, 2024 · Aside from the obvious spelling difference, the words everyone and everybody are very similar. WebGrammarians actually agree that the words everyone and everybody are singular. Grammar Girl [...] says, everyone sounds like a lot of people, but in grammar land, everyone is a singular noun and takes a singular verb. WebEveryone, everybody, everything and everywhere are indefinite pronouns. We use them to refer to a total number of people, things and places. We write them as one word: His name was Henry but everyone called him Harry. All your clothes are clean.
